Seabourn hot spots
The Yachts of Seabourn ships Pride, Spirit and Legend are being upgraded to a wi-fi “hot zone.”
The new service allowing guests to connect to the internet at their wi-fi equipped laptops and PDAs without plugging in will be available this summer, the cruise line said.
Cruising guests will be able to send and receive web-based mail, or surf the net either in their suites or inmost public areas of Seabourn’s three yacht-like ships.
In addition to convenience, Seabourn says it has a new and more economical satellite service that will drastically lower costs for internet connections and telephone calls.
The previous charge of $12.50 per minute has been reduced to $4.95.
